9 Clever Tips for Buying Your Dream Home Even in a Tough Market

Buying a home is an exciting and rewarding experience, but it can also be challenging, especially in a tough real estate market.

However, with the right knowledge and strategy, you can still find your dream home even when the competition is fierce.

In this article, we will share 9 clever tips to help you navigate the tough market and increase your chances of buying your dream home.

1. Get Pre-Approved for a Mortgage

Before you start house hunting, it’s essential to get pre-approved for a mortgage. This will give you a clear idea of your budget and show sellers that you are a serious buyer. Having a pre-approval letter in hand will also give you a competitive edge over other buyers.

2. Work with a Knowledgeable Real Estate Agent

A knowledgeable real estate agent can be your greatest asset in a tough market. They have access to exclusive listings, market insights, and negotiation skills that can help you find and secure your dream home. Make sure to choose an agent who has experience in the area you want to buy in.

3. Be Flexible with Your Criteria

In a tough market, it’s important to be flexible with your criteria. You may need to compromise on certain features or locations to find a home within your budget. Make a list of your must-haves and nice-to-haves, and be open to adjusting it as you explore the market.

4. Act Quickly

In a competitive market, time is of the essence. When you find a home that meets your criteria, don’t hesitate to make an offer. Delaying can give other buyers an opportunity to swoop in and make a better offer. Work closely with your real estate agent to move quickly and submit a strong offer.

5. Be Prepared for Bidding Wars

In a tough market, bidding wars are common. It’s important to be prepared for this possibility and have a strategy in place. Set a maximum budget and stick to it. Consider including an escalation clause in your offer to automatically increase your bid if there are competing offers.

6. Consider Off-Market Opportunities

Off-market opportunities are properties that are not listed on the MLS or public websites. These can be a hidden gem in a tough market. Work closely with your real estate agent to explore off-market options and increase your chances of finding your dream home.

7. Be Willing to Renovate

In a tough market, finding a turnkey home within your budget can be challenging. Consider homes that need some renovation or cosmetic updates. This can give you an opportunity to buy at a lower price and customize the home to your liking.

8. Stay Positive and Persistent

Buying a home in a tough market can be discouraging at times, but it’s important to stay positive and persistent. Keep searching, attending open houses, and making offers. Your dream home is out there, and with perseverance, you will find it.

9. Don’t Settle

Lastly, don’t settle for a home that doesn’t meet your needs or make you happy. It’s better to wait and keep searching than to buy a home that you’re not truly satisfied with. Trust your instincts and keep working towards finding your dream home.
